    How to fix Eaton 9PX 3000 RT overtemperature LED on and beeping?
    • N
      Nancy WatsonAug 28, 2025
      If the UPS internal temperature is too high or a fan has failed and the Eaton UPS overtemperature LED is on, and it beeps every 3 seconds: * Clear vents and remove any heat sources. * Ensure airflow around the UPS is not restricted. * Restart the UPS. If the condition persists, shut down the UPS and contact your service representative. If the UPS transferred to Bypass mode, it will return to normal operation when the temperature drops 5°C below the warning level.

    Why does my Eaton 9PX 3000 RT UPS not start?
    • L
      Loretta BuckleySep 1, 2025
      If the Eaton UPS does not start, check the input connections. Also, if the UPS Status menu displays the "Remote Power Off" notice, inactivate the RPO input, because the Remote Power Off (RPO) switch might be active or the RPO connector might be missing.

    What does it mean when the battery fault LED is on and my Eaton 9PX 3000 RT is beeping continuously?
    • D
      daviselizabethSep 9, 2025
      If the battery fault LED is on and the Eaton UPS beeps continuously, verify that all batteries are properly connected. Start a new battery test: if the condition persists, contact your service representative. The battery test failed due to bad or disconnected batteries, or the battery minimum voltage was reached in ABM cycling mode.

Eaton 9PX 3000 RT Specifications

General IconGeneral
Power Rating3000 VA / 2700 W
Form FactorRack/Tower
TopologyDouble Conversion Online
Runtime at 70% Load9 minutes
Frequency50/60 Hz
Operating Temperature0 to 40 °C
Input Voltage200-240 VAC
Output Voltage220/230/240 VAC
Battery TypeSealed lead-acid
EfficiencyUp to 94%
Output Receptacles(8) IEC 320 C13
CommunicationUSB, RS-232
Network ManagementOptional Network Card
Typical Recharge Time3 hours
Interface PortsUSB, RS-232
Storage Temperature-15 to 45 °C
Humidity0-95% non-condensing
